Hello Marta,

Handover notes for the Wordloom crossword generator. During my shift the fill solver exhausted memory twice on 21x21 themed grids; I capped worker heap at 4 GB and added a retry with a relaxed symmetry constraint. Clue-pairing jobs are otherwise healthy. Please ensure the release manager knows the heap cap must ship with build 3.7, or staging will regress. Full timeline is in the incident log. Follow-ups can be sent here.

escalation mailbox, yajeg-bageg: quenax.olidor@lumiccorp.internal

Handover — Fernlux transcoding farm. Short version: node pool B is draining, leave it alone. Queue backlog clears by morning. If the orchestrator wedges, restart via the Quarrel dashboard, not SSH. Escalations go to the media platform rotation. To unseal the orchestrator's admin mode after a restart, enter the recovery passphrase below.

unlock words, fahop-yageg: ralwyn-kelath

Management Meeting Minutes — Gross-Margin Review

Attendees: department heads, chaired by T. Marrow.

Gross margin fell to 31.2% in Q2, driven by freight costs and discounting on the Orvex line. Pricing team to model a 2% list increase. Procurement to renegotiate packaging contracts by month end. Next review in six weeks. Strategic implications are set out in the confidential note that follows.

board note of bawep-tajef: Queniusek Systems plans to raise the Quenvan list price by 53.1 percent in March. The pricing group signed off on a budget of $176.4 million for Project Drueth. The renewal with Casionix Partners closes at $142.5 million a year, 8.3 percent below the last contract. Project Fraax slips by six weeks because of the tooling delay.

Welcome aboard. As of Monday, ownership of the Harkvale video transcoding farm has moved from the media-infra group to the delivery team. For you this means: job submissions still go through the Coldbrook queue, but capacity requests and priority overrides follow the new approval flow documented in the Ravenshold wiki. The old escalation alias is retired. Encoder profile changes are frozen until the handover audit completes next week. Direct all questions about the farm to the new owner named below.

named custodian: Brivan Eliath Quenox Frador